help: 1996 mustang cobra


Hey guys, i went to go look at a mustang cobra yesterday, and it looks fine and everything, but there is a problem.

The muffler rattles when started, because there is a hair line crack in the body. I had one person tell me its nothing big, but then one guy who said that the cars frame is twisted and probably that is why the exhaust is hitting the frame.


any help?

A car fax would be a good place to start if you want to see if it has been in a major wreck. Just like any time you buy a used car, it wouldn't be a bad idea to have a mechanic check it out. In this case, take it by a body shop and they can usually tell you real quick if the car has been in a major accident. Than run it by a muffler shop and have them look at it.

If the owner of the car doesn't want you doing all this investigating than walk away.

Yeah, I'm kind of in the same boat actually. My car has developed this nasty rattle. Usually it is between 1500-1800 RPM, but occasionaly at idle. It's a real annoying metallic rattle.

I took it to my muffler guy Tuesday and after checking everything out he told me it's some of the chambers inside the muffler coming loose and rattling real bad. Looks like I'm getting a new exhaust soon.
